Decorate a shelf, desk, or study with this expressive antique French hunting dog composition, crafted circa 1880. The sculptural group depicts two hounds in motion, captured mid-pursuit with powerful musculature and alert posture, connected by a chain collar that enhances the narrative of the hunt.
Cast in spelter and finished with a rich patinated surface, the dogs are mounted on a textured terracotta base modeled to resemble rocky terrain, adding depth and contrast to the composition. The detailing throughout, from the defined anatomy to the expressive faces and flowing lines, reflects the naturalistic style popular in late 19th century animalier works.
The sculpture is in excellent condition commensurate with age and use, and adorns a warm, time-softened patina across both the figures and base. A striking decorative accent for a library, office, or hunting lodge interior.
